Pandas是一个开源的数据分析和数据处理工具,它提供了丰富的数据结构和数据分析函数,可以方便地进行数据清洗、转换、分析和可视化等操作。在Pandas中,可以使用to_datetime函数将字符串转换为datetime.datetime类型。
to_datetime函数是Pandas中的一个方法,用于将字符串转换为datetime.datetime类型。它可以接受多种不同格式的字符串作为输入,并将其转换为对应的日期时间对象。to_datetime函数的语法如下:
pandas.to_datetime(arg, format=None, errors='raise', dayfirst=False, yearfirst=False, utc=None, box=True, exact=True, unit=None, infer_datetime_format=False, origin='unix', cache=False)
参数说明:
使用示例:
import pandas as pd
# 将单个字符串转换为datetime.datetime类型
date_str = '2022-01-01'
date = pd.to_datetime(date_str)
print(date)
# 输出:2022-01-01 00:00:00
# 将字符串列表转换为datetime.datetime类型
date_str_list = ['2022-01-01', '2022-01-02', '2022-01-03']
dates = pd.to_datetime(date_str_list)
print(dates)
# 输出:
# 0 2022-01-01
# 1 2022-01-02
# 2 2022-01-03
# dtype: datetime64[ns]
# 将Series中的字符串转换为datetime.datetime类型
date_series = pd.Series(date_str_list)
dates = pd.to_datetime(date_series)
print(dates)
# 输出:
# 0 2022-01-01
# 1 2022-01-02
# 2 2022-01-03
# dtype: datetime64[ns]
Pandas提供了丰富的日期时间处理功能,可以对转换后的datetime.datetime类型进行各种操作,如提取年、月、日、小时、分钟、秒等信息,计算时间差,进行日期的加减运算等。此外,Pandas还可以方便地进行时间序列的处理和分析。
腾讯云提供了云计算相关的产品和服务,其中与数据分析和处理相关的产品包括云数据库TDSQL、云数据仓库CDW、云数据湖CDL等。您可以通过访问腾讯云官网(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用指南。
领取专属 10元无门槛券
手把手带您无忧上云